It was a whirlwind of a summer! And today we officially transition to Autumn.

As the season changes, it often evokes a bittersweet feeling. It’s a moment of transition—where the warmth and freedom of summer begin to give way to the cool, reflective air of autumn. It carries a sense of nostalgia, as it marks the end of long days, late sunsets, and carefree moments spent outdoors. It’s a reminder of how quickly time passes, and it invites both reflection on the memories made during the season and anticipation for the quieter, more introspective months ahead.

There’s also a kind of magic in the last day of summer, as people try to savour the final moments of warmth and light before the seasons shift. Whether it’s the lingering sunlight, the changing colours, or the subtle chill in the evening breeze, the last day of summer symbolises both an ending and a beginning—a time to celebrate and to let go.
